Tato Melgar is a percussionist known for adding color, drive, and Latin-influenced texture to roots-rock settings — most notably as a longtime member of Lukas Nelson & Promise of the Real (POTR). His percussion work helps give the band its distinctive live energy, where the groove stays thick and rolling without losing the raw power of rock.
Within POTR, Melgar has been part of the group’s core lineup alongside Lukas Nelson, drummer Anthony LoGerfo, and bassist Corey McCormick. In an interview with Traveling Boy, LoGerfo described the band as “pretty much based here, and Maui and also ‘on-the-road’ for the most part,” reflecting their coastal home base and constant touring lifestyle.
Melgar is also closely tied to the wider Neil Young orbit through Promise of the Real. He appears on major Neil Young + POTR projects, with documented credits showing him on releases such as The Visitor (Neil Young and Promise of the Real).
What he’s doing now: In June 2024, Promise of the Real announced a hiatus after 15 years, with Lukas continuing to write, record, and perform while members pursue other projects.
Recordings / credits: Melgar’s credits include extensive work with Lukas Nelson & Promise of the Real and the Neil Young + Promise of the Real era, with credits documented in personnel listings and discography databases.
